If you are looking for the best weapons to craft and use in Roblox Devil Hunter, I’ve got you covered with my tier list.

As you may know, the best weapons in Devil Hunter are locked behind the game’s crafting system, which you can access via the Crafting Table inside the Division 2 office.

The higher the rarity of the weapon goes and the type of the weapon, the more materials you need.

And since farming materials in the game takes time and is a little painful with some bugs and glitches, further making the process daunting, knowing about the best weapons will help a lot.

Devil Hunter weapons tier list

Devil Hunter get weapons 5

My weapons tier list for Devil Hunter is based on the PvE and PvP experience I have had with some of the higher rarity weapons, community opinions, the rarity and attacks, how well it aligns with the skills and such other factors.

There’s a lot of testing still left to do. And thus, expect a shift in rankings as I spend more time in the game:

TIERWEAPON
SKasaka’s Fang, Kuchigatana, Cobalt Bloom
AScarlet Queen, Punk Hazard, Devil Crusher, Locust Knife
BRazorfang, Velvet Knife, Locust Knife, Model: UZI, Razor Halberd
CShibuki, Left & Right, Devil’s Maw, Yukimura, Greenshot
DKitchen Knife, Katana, Broad Axe, 1911

Best weapon in Devil Hunter

Devil Hunter Kuchigatana Crafting

Here are the best weapons in Devil Hunter:

  • Light Weapon: Kasaka’s Fang
  • Medium Weapon: Kuchigatana
  • Heavy Weapon: Scissor Blade
  • Martial Arts: Devil Crusher
  • Firearm: Cobalt Bloom
